Output 57eb68c3e20e24ff05711a4084e6a9d833c80ea7b2670de247e59be78e23b58a:0

value
266868
script pubkey
OP_0 OP_PUSHBYTES_20 b8a48bf10f895b0b2e6e7193b492f3e5b8015c6f
address
bc1qhzjghug039dsktnwwxfmfyhnukuqzhr09mcqrt
transaction
57eb68c3e20e24ff05711a4084e6a9d833c80ea7b2670de247e59be78e23b58a
spent
true